Emperor74,
The exclusive legislative jurisdiction of the federal government extends to defense, foreign affairs, immigration, transportation, communications, and currency standards.
The Provincial governments ?share concurrent? entrusted with powers in several areas, including civil law, refugee and expellee matters, public welfare, land management, consumer protection, public health, and the collection of vital statistics (data on births, deaths, and marriages). In the areas of mass media, nature conservation, regional planning, and public service regulations, framework legislation limits the federal government's role to offering general policy guidelines, which the Provincial Govt then act upon by means of detailed legislation. The areas of shared responsibility for the PC and the federal government were enlarged by an amendment to the Basic Law in 1969 (Articles 91a and 91b), which calls for joint action in areas of broad social concern such as higher education, regional economic development, and agricultural reform.

Daily Mirror picking up on the story:
SLAF denies downing of Kfir
The Air Force yesterday rejected reports on the pro-LTTE Tamilnet website that an SLAF Kfir Jet was shot down by the LTTE in the Iranamadu area during an air raid.
?The Air Force totally denies such reports and it is yet another ?fabricated? story,? Air Force Spokesman Ajantha Silva said.
The Media Center for National Security said all aircraft of the Sri Lanka Air Force had returned to their bases following their routine reconnaissance and other strike missions over Tiger held areas and none of them was reported missing.
Meanwhile, the LTTE claimed a Sri Lanka Air Force jet fighter was attacked by its air-defense system when the bomber approached the airfield of the Tamileealm Air Force in Iranaimadu around 2:30 p.m yesterday. The Tamilnet website quoted LTTE military spokesman Irasiah Ilanthirayan as saying that the SLAF bomber had plunged into the sea, following a loud explosion.
